HTML5自适应屏幕:拥抱响应式设计的变革
微信号
AI自助建站398元:18925225629
1. 响应式设计的兴起
随着移动设备的普及,网站需要适应不同尺寸和分辨率的屏幕。响应式设计应运而生,它是一种技术,使网站能够自动调整布局以适应多种设备。
2. HTML5的响应式功能
HTML5为响应式设计提供了多种功能:
- 弹性容器:通过 `flexbox` 和 `grid` 布局,元素可以根据容器的大小灵活调整。
- 相对单位: `rem` 和 `vh` 等单位允许元素的尺寸相对于父元素或视口大小。
- 媒体查询: `@media` 块可用于针对特定设备或屏幕尺寸设置不同的样式。
3. 实现自适应屏幕
要使网站自适应屏幕,需要采取以下步骤:
1. 使用弹性容器:为页面布局指定 `flex` 或 `grid` 布局,以允许元素响应屏幕尺寸。
2. 使用相对单位:为块级元素的字体大小和间距使用 `rem` 或 `vh` 等相对单位。
3. 使用媒体查询:针对不同设备或屏幕尺寸设置特定的样式,如:
```html
@media (max-width: 768px) {
/ 在最大宽度为768px的设备上应用样式 /
}
```
4. 响应式设计的好处
自适应屏幕的网站具有以下好处:
- 无缝的用户体验:网站在所有设备上都能正常显示和使用。
- 提升搜索引擎优化(SEO):谷歌手册对移动设备友好的网站提供排名提升。
- 提高转化率:自适应网站可以为所有用户提供更好的导航和交互,从而提升转化率。
- 节省成本:通过创建单一网站来适应多种设备,可以避免开发和维护多个版本。
5. 最佳实践
为了实现最佳的响应式设计,遵循以下最佳实践:
- 测试多设备:在不同尺寸和分辨率的设备上测试网站,确保其在所有屏幕上都能正确显示。
- 优化图像:优化图像尺寸和格式,以快速加载和响应屏幕尺寸。
- 避免绝对定位:对于响应式设计,绝对定位元素可能导致布局问题。
- 使用渐进增强:在不支持 JavaScript 或 CSS 媒体查询的浏览器上,提供次佳体验。
6. 未来展望
随着设备多样性和屏幕尺寸的持续增长,响应式设计变得必不可缺。HTML5的自适应功能使开发人员能够创建适应不断变化的技术格局的动态网站。随着技术的进步,我们预计响应式设计会变得更加先进和广泛采用。
微信号
AI自助建站398元:18925225629
相关文章
发表评论